- [ ] **Step 7: Breaker override escrow.** After sealing the signing keys for the Tallgrove upstream API circuit breaker, confirm the support team can force the breaker open during a full outage. The override bundle lives in the sealed escrow drawer and is useless without its unlock phrase. Two ceremony witnesses must initial this step before proceeding. The escrow bundle is decrypted with the recovery passphrase that follows.

vault phrase of kahip-kahop = holath-quenmir

Changelog 3.8.0 — Verdanthaus greenhouse controller. The setting GH_DRIFT_WINDOW has been renamed to SENSOR_DRIFT_WINDOW_MIN to clarify units after repeated confusion caused bad drift compensation on the humidity probes. New team members: the old name is no longer read, so controllers using it silently fall back to defaults and over-correct. Update your local env files to the new name, and note that the calibration service also needs its upload secret present, set like this.

vault entry, yahif-yajep: COURIER_KEY29=b802bdf8034096b65a51c6ba5abe2

Migration step 4: Re-point the kiosk watchdog

Quick one for the security review. The Brightstall kiosk app used to let the watchdog restart itself with inherited root perms — not great, we know. In this step you move the watchdog under the new sandboxed supervisor so it can only bounce the kiosk process, nothing else. Flip the unit file, restart the supervisor, and confirm the kiosk recovers within ten seconds. Once that checks out, apply the settings below.

service settings:
PRAIX_LOG_LEVEL=error
PRAIX_METRICS_HOST=metrics.praix.qorvelcorp.corp
PRAIX_POOL_SIZE=16

Hey, new folks — Cratepath is the service that turns raw warehouse orders into optimized pick routes. It runs a solver pass every few minutes, scoring routes by walk distance and bin congestion. If pickers complain about weird zig-zag routes, check whether the congestion weights got reset after a deploy; that's the usual culprit. Restarting the solver is safe mid-shift, since in-flight pick lists are never recalled. Before touching anything, note that the optimizer reads its tuning from the following values.

service settings:
PRAWYN_PIN=9848
PRAWYN_METRICS_HOST=metrics.prawyn.lumicworks.corp
PRAWYN_LOG_LEVEL=warn
PRAWYN_TENANT=pelius